Milrinone is a potent phosphodiesterase III inhibitor that is commonly used in the treatment of heart failure. It works by increasing intracellular levels of cyclic adenosine monophosphate (cAMP), leading to positive inotropic and vasodilatory effects. Milrinone is typically administered intravenously and is known for its rapid onset of action, making it especially useful in acute settings where quick hemodynamic support is crucial.
One of the key advantages of milrinone is its ability to improve cardiac output without significantly increasing myocardial oxygen consumption. This makes it a valuable option for patients with heart failure who may be at risk of further cardiac ischemia. However, milrinone is not without its limitations, as it can also cause hypotension and arrhythmias in some patients. Hence, milrinone plays a vital role in the management of heart failure and continues to be a cornerstone of treatment in many clinical settings.
